These are the basic designs thus far. Dzorma (Zor~mah) is the black chick, who I just adore as a character. Her Village will be at the base of a mountain, very bayou like. The animals will all be hybrids, you know, to be part of the solution and not part of the problem. The main pets in the village are Husaliie (Who-saw-eh). About the size of a van, with a goat's hair and horns, but a crocodile face, tail and rear legs. Her attire will be Sherpa like in winter, and tribal in summer.
Misael (Miss-ale), the traveling merchant, is prepared for all climates. He is a master of obtaining what you need or want, and his clothing will be mostly unflattering and large. He will have originally come from a very noble family, but grew tired of the monotony. It will show in this character that he loves seeing new places, providing hundreds of valuable services.

Misael is easily the more complex character, but Pyrea (Pie-ray-ah) is a close second. She was an adult at 5 years old, living on the streets, attaching herself to people that would make food available. She may have been sick and awkward, but she was sharp. Due to the fact that she wandered the streets of the Capital City, she would listen to the scholars speak of politics. At 12 she joins a brothel, cutting a deal with the Lady of the House. As she grew older, her influence became stronger along with her stunning beauty. That is where our Prince comes in.
Amarion is the prince of a dead kingdom. Meaning essentially that with his father gone, and his brother royally fucking everything up, he was left with the horrible messy rebuild. Since his cred is already shot due to the completely retarded family, Misael will send Pyrea to advise him.
